Re: [robertl@sco.com: threads RH6/Sparc vs. GDB]



> > From what I recall, sys/ptrace.h and one of the GDB headers were
> > each trying to outsmart the other.
>
> No, it is two system headers. /usr/include/asm-sparc/ptrace.h
> (included via a dizzying cascade of includes from
> /usr/include/signal.h) and /usr/include/sys/ptrace.h.  The former
> contains "#define PTRACE_GETREGS 12" and the latter has an enum which
> contains "PTRACE_GETREGS = 12".

Yes, that does definitely sound familar now that you mention it.  This
has been in my local tree for several months, so I had forgotten the
details.  Only by looking at the cpp output does it become "obvious".
